What You Will Be Doing
As a Senior Cybersecurity Analyst, you’ll play a key leadership role on the front lines of cyber defense, serving as both a hands-on expert and a mentor within our Security Operations Center. You'll lead advanced threat detection, analysis, and response efforts, proactively hunt for adversary activity, and continuously enhance the cybersecurity posture of our clients. This role is ideal for experienced analysts who thrive in fast-paced environments and are passionate about stopping sophisticated threats before they cause harm.
This is an on-site position working out of the DOT Security - Security Operations Center in Mettawa, IL.

Responsibilities
Lead the investigation of real-time alerts from SIEM platforms and other security tools, ensuring timely identification of potential threats
Perform in-depth forensic analysis of firewall logs, IDS/IPS alerts, and packet captures to validate or dismiss security events
Correlate information across multiple data sources to detect advanced persistent threats (APTs), identify attack paths, and assess risk
Author detailed incident reports and provide high-impact recommendations to internal and external stakeholders
Drive threat-hunting initiatives based on intelligence feeds, behavioral analytics, and emerging TTPs
Identify and assess indicators of compromise (IOCs), attack patterns, and threat actor behavior to stay ahead of adversaries
Perform in-depth investigations of phishing campaigns, lateral movement attempts, and zero-day exploitation tactics
Collaborate with threat intelligence teams to refine detection use cases and enrich alerting logic
Act as a lead responder for escalated incidents, guiding triage, containment, remediation, and recovery activities
Refine and execute incident response playbooks; contribute to the continuous evolution of SOC processes
Tune security toolsets to improve signal-to-noise ratios, reduce false positives, and increase detection efficacy
Provide mentorship and knowledge-sharing to junior analysts to build team capability
Partner with infrastructure and engineering teams to implement improvements based on SOC findings
Design and maintain custom detection rules and alerting logic aligned to evolving threat landscapes
Lead efforts to enhance SOC workflows through automation, process improvement, and playbook development
Things We Are Looking For
Core Competencies
Strong critical thinking and investigative mindset with the ability to independently solve complex security challenges
Excellent written and verbal communication skills, including the ability to clearly explain findings to non-technical audiences
Demonstrated leadership in SOC environments and a track record of driving measurable improvements in threat detection or response
Technical & Cybersecurity Expertise
Deep understanding of modern cyber threats, threat actor behavior, and exploitation methods
Proficiency with the MITRE ATT&CK framework and threat intelligence application
Experience with advanced attack types, including buffer overflows, code injection, covert channels, and malware evasion tactics
Strong grasp of networking fundamentals (TCP/IP, OSI model) and security infrastructure (firewalls, VPNs, SIEM, EDR/XDR, etc.)
Hands-On Experience
5+ years of experience handling/leading SOC incident or investigations, a plus
Proven experience with enterprise-grade SIEM tools and log analysis platforms
Background in IT infrastructure roles such as Systems Administrator, Network Engineer, or similar, with a security-first mindset
Experience performing malware analysis or reverse engineering is a strong plus
